F. <br />15) The applicant must provide sidewalks on both sides of Street B to better serve the single <br />family residential area. <br />16) Additional trail segments along the east side of Inwood Avenue from 5th Street to 1 oth Street <br />and along 10th Street from Inwood Avenue to the Greenbelt Buffer Trail must be <br />incorporated into the plans. <br />17) The applicant must work with the City to ensure compliance with the City's shorel and <br />provisions and the standards of the SD and MN DNR related to shoreland areas of <br />designated public waters. <br />18) The development plans must be updated so that all multi -family housing is located south of <br />zl� <br />5th Street. No multi -family residential development will be allowed north of 5' Street. <br />19) Sidewalks shall be provided on one side of every street, including all cul-de-sacs and loop <br />roads within the development with the exception of 9th Street. <br />20) The trail within the eastern buffer area near the property boundary with the Stonegate <br />subdivision shall be located as far west as possible on the site. <br />2 1 ) The lots at the far eastern cul-de-sacs in neighborhoods E, F, and H shall be platted as <br />designer (larger) lots in accordance with the lot so designated on the PUD Concept Plan, <br />22) The developer shall consider adding a small park to the northwest portion of the site subject <br />to review and comment by the Park Commission. <br />23) The high density housing area shall be limited to a maximum of 15 units per acre. <br />24) The design for structures within the commercial and multi -family areas shall be consistent <br />with the overall design throughout the development, including the single-family <br />neighborhoods. <br />25) All cul-de-sac streets shall meet the City's maximum length requirements as specified in the <br />City's Subdivision Ordinance. <br />Passed and duly adopted this 16th day of September 2014 by the City Council of the City of Lake <br />Elmo, Minnesota. <br />wm <br />Mike Pearson, Mayor <br />ATTEST: <br />,,O'fam Bell, City Clerk <br />Resolution 2014-072 <br />
